What is Texas Roadhouse Honey Cinnamon Butter?

Texas Roadhouse’s Honey Cinnamon Butter is a light, whipped butter that combines the warmth and flavor of honey and cinnamon. It goes well with the restaurant’s freshly made rolls, but it may also be used with a variety of other foods.

Key Ingredients

The primary ingredients are:

  • Butter: usually unsalted butter that has been melted to a smooth consistency.
  • Honey: adds the characteristic sweetness.
  • Cinnamon: Adds flavor and warmth.
  • Powdered Sugar: contributes to the texture’s light, fluffy texture and intensifies the sweetness.

When making handmade versions, you may customize the amount of cinnamon and honey to suit your taste and add a touch of salt if you’re using unsalted butter.

How to Make Texas Roadhouse Honey Cinnamon Butter at Home

It takes only five minutes to make this surprisingly easy butter at home.

Ingredients:

  • 1/2 cup softened butter (unsalted or salted)
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 1/4 cup powdered sugar (optional for added sweetness)

Instructions:

  1. Whip the butter: Use an electric mixer to whip the softened butter until it’s light and fluffy.
  2. Add the honey and cinnamon: Pour in the honey and cinnamon, and continue whipping until the ingredients are well combined.
  3. Serve or store: Once ready, you can use the butter immediately or store it in the fridge for later use.

This butter works well with sweet potatoes as well as other breads, biscuits, and pancakes.

How to Store Honey Cinnamon Butter

An airtight container can be used to keep honey cinnamon butter:

  • In the refrigerator: Lasts about 1 week.
  • At room temperature: Safe for up to 1-2 days if kept in a cool place.
  • In the freezer: Can be stored for up to 3 months. Just allow it to thaw in the refrigerator before use.

To keep the butter’s fluffy, spreadable quality, it’s ideal to let it soften at room temperature before serving.
